* Menuconfig will not treat 'select FOO' as a real dependencyFelix Fietkau2007-02-121-14/+34
| | | | | | | | | | | thus if BAR depends on FOO and FOO depends on other config options, these dependencies will not be checked. To fix this, we simply emit all of FOO's depends (only real dependencies, no select) for BAR as well. git-svn-id: svn://svn.openwrt.org/openwrt/trunk@6293 3c298f89-4303-0410-b956-a3cf2f4a3e73
